Job Title:HVAC Project Manager

Job Summary:EMCOR Services Combustioneer has an immediate opening for aHVAC Project Manager in Lanham Maryland.This position is responsible for daily operations of designated construction projects; from initial planning to completion under the contract. Oversees the contract budget; supervision of project personnel supervision of new construction and remodeling of facilities; repair and maintenance and systematic inspection planning and accomplishing repairs to facilities.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Fully responsible for the successful completion of all aspects of the assigned project/contract between Combustioneer and the client.
  • Prepares monthly financial forecasts and monthly updates. Ensures that the project is managed in a manner that meets all safety/contractual requirements and financial goals.
  • Manages the overall operations of the contract including: the performance of daily operations and scheduled milestones.
  • Evaluate and insure the efficient operation of the project controlling operational expenses at a minimum level which is consistent with sound operations practices and contractual requirements.
  • Provide administrative and technical direction and supervision to staff in completing projects.
  • Supervise the negotiation and bids for subcontracts and equipment/material suppliers related to assigned projects.
  • Discuss plan and delegate major project assignments to supervisory staff as required/necessary; determine project execution priorities.
  • Coordinates purchase of necessary supplies equipment and services from appropriate sources and maintains proper inventory control in concert with the company warehouse specialist.
  • Maintains liaison with architects engineers and contractors/ subcontractors engaged in plant expansion renovation or other major projects.
  • Maintains sufficient records files controls procedures to insure management and work production.
  • Develop training sessions for employees who require them.
  • Maintains a strong safety program

Qualifications:

  • Project Manager with at least 7 years experience in construction with at least ten years direct experience in Heating Ventilation Air Conditioning and Direct Digital control (DDC) systems maintenance repairs and installation.
  • Must have knowledge of submitting written proposals scopes of work scheduling and coordinating project contractors and other assigned personnel; a thorough understanding of schedules and operations and the ability to meet demanding customer requirements.
  • Strong experience with Windows & MS Office
  • Knowledge of facilities mechanical and electrical systems
  • Demonstrated skill at developing and nurturing client relationships
  • Excellent communication skills verbal and written
  • Ability to organize and lead a group of people work independently or as member of a team and to adapt to ever changing priorities
  • Familiarity with contracting procedures
  • Ability to plan organize coordinate direct and control all aspects of a construction project.
  • Ability to work with the customer to find amiable solutions to difficult issues.
  • Ability to work with management Systems and variety of skilled/unskilled professional administrative and industry personnel.
  • Basic knowledge of office administration plant management reporting budgeting and control and business operations blueprints buildings grounds equipment housekeeping construction repair maintenance purchasing inventory control fire safety management BOCA & OSHA codes.
  • Must be willing and able to travel up to 25 miles from the site
